This book is a comic collection that has 40 people working on the same theme. So there’s a constant change in artistic style and perspective which I really appreciated. It’s informative in both intelligence information and lived life experience.

Some of the inspirational messages seem a little ableist, or assumed people had a strong, healthy support system. But overall enjoyable to read others stories about living in a world that doesn’t accommodate varying neurotypes.

This was a wonderful collection of comics exploring the experience of those of us who are Autistic. It was a great book to start Autism Acceptance Month with. Loved hearing from so many different Autistic voices including both individuals who are self-diagnosed and formally diagnosed. If you want a great intro into the autistic experience this book is a great choice.
